Switch rails to state mapping

This commit is contained in:
Mike Primm 2022-02-11 00:40:52 -06:00
parent 93c84ef15e
commit de344869b7
2 changed files with 10 additions and 20 deletions

View File

@ -325,33 +325,27 @@ boxblock:id=stone_button,id=oak_button,id=spruce_button,id=birch_button,id=jungl
# Powered rails - flat - east/west
# Detector rails - flat - east/west
# Activator Rail - flat - east/west
[-1.16.5]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=0,data=6,patch0=HorizY001ZTop
[1.17-]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=0,data=1,data=12,data=13,patch0=HorizY001ZTop
patchblock:id=powered_rail,id=detector_rail,id=activator_rail,state=shape:north_south,patch0=HorizY001ZTop
# Powered rails - flat - north/south
# Detector rails - flat - north/south
# Activator Rail - flat - north/south
[-1.16.5]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=1,data=7,patch0=HorizY001ZTop@90
[1.17-]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=2,data=3,data=14,data=15,patch0=HorizY001ZTop@90
patchblock:id=powered_rail,id=detector_rail,id=activator_rail,state=shape:east_west,patch0=HorizY001ZTop@90
# Powered rails - ascending to south
# Detector rails - ascending to south
# Activator Rail - ascending to south
[-1.16.5]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=2,data=8,patch0=SlopeXUpZTop
[1.17-]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=4,data=5,data=16,data=17,patch0=SlopeXUpZTop
patchblock:id=powered_rail,id=detector_rail,id=activator_rail,state=shape:ascending_east,patch0=SlopeXUpZTop
# Powered rails - ascending to north
# Detector rails - ascending to north
# Activator Rail - ascending to north
[-1.16.5]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=3,data=9,patch0=SlopeXUpZTop@180
[1.17-]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=6,data=7,data=18,data=19,patch0=SlopeXUpZTop@180
patchblock:id=powered_rail,id=detector_rail,id=activator_rail,state=shape:ascending_west,patch0=SlopeXUpZTop@180
# Powered rails - ascending to east
# Detector rails - ascending to east
# Activator Rail - ascending to east
[-1.16.5]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=4,data=10,patch0=SlopeXUpZTop@270
[1.17-]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=8,data=9,data=20,data=21,patch0=SlopeXUpZTop@270
patchblock:id=powered_rail,id=detector_rail,id=activator_rail,state=shape:ascending_north,patch0=SlopeXUpZTop@270
# Powered rails - ascending to west
# Detector rails - ascending to west
# Activator Rail - ascending to west
[-1.16.5]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=5,data=21,patch0=SlopeXUpZTop@90
[1.17-]patchblock:id=powered_rail,id=detector_rail,id=activator_rail,data=10,data=11,data=22,data=23,patch0=SlopeXUpZTop@90
patchblock:id=powered_rail,id=detector_rail,id=activator_rail,state=shape:ascending_south,patch0=SlopeXUpZTop@90
# Ladder
patchblock:id=ladder,data=0,data=1,patch0=VertX0In@270

View File

@ -788,18 +788,14 @@ block:id=red_bed,patch0=0:red_bed,patch1=1:red_bed,patch2=2:red_bed,patch3=3:red
block:id=black_bed,patch0=0:black_bed,patch1=1:black_bed,patch2=2:black_bed,patch3=3:black_bed,patch4=4:black_bed,patch5=5:black_bed,patch6=6:black_bed,patch7=7:black_bed,patch8=8:black_bed,patch9=9:black_bed,patch10=10:black_bed,patch11=11:black_bed,patch12=12:black_bed,patch13=13:black_bed,patch14=14:black_bed,patch15=15:black_bed,patch16=16:black_bed,patch17=17:black_bed,transparency=TRANSPARENT
# Powered rail - powered
[-1.16.5]block:id=powered_rail,data=0-5,patch0=0:powered_rail_on,transparency=TRANSPARENT
[1.17-]block:id=powered_rail,data=0-11,patch0=0:powered_rail_on,transparency=TRANSPARENT
block:id=powered_rail,state=powered:true,patch0=0:powered_rail_on,transparency=TRANSPARENT
# Powered rail - unpowered
[-1.16.5]block:id=powered_rail,data=6-11,patch0=0:powered_rail,transparency=TRANSPARENT
[1.17-]block:id=powered_rail,data=12-23,patch0=0:powered_rail,transparency=TRANSPARENT
block:id=powered_rail,state=powered:false,patch0=0:powered_rail,transparency=TRANSPARENT
# Detector rail - powered
[-1.16.5]block:id=detector_rail,data=0-5,patch0=0:detector_rail_on,transparency=TRANSPARENT
[1.17-]block:id=detector_rail,data=0-11,patch0=0:detector_rail_on,transparency=TRANSPARENT
block:id=detector_rail,state=powered:true,patch0=0:detector_rail_on,transparency=TRANSPARENT
# Detector rail - unpowered
[-1.16.5]block:id=detector_rail,data=6-11,patch0=0:detector_rail,transparency=TRANSPARENT
[1.17-]block:id=detector_rail,data=12-23,patch0=0:detector_rail,transparency=TRANSPARENT
block:id=detector_rail,state=powered:false,patch0=0:detector_rail,transparency=TRANSPARENT
# Web